But big and crazy things have been happening down here. The first ward I was in in this state has split and now those two wards are working to split again so that's great. This Stake has the goal to split and so we've been working hard at it helping people come back, baptizing some saints, getting people on family history and sending names to the temple, helping prospective Elders receive the Melchizedek Priesthood, sending names out to where they need to be at, helping people get active temple recommends, etc etc. So with all that has been going on the twelve have taken notice and have invited Prez to come speak with them and all the area 70's and explain for 15 min what has been happening down here. Also the head of the Family Search got in contact with Prez and told him anything he needs he's got it due to all that's been happening down here. So lots of good things have been happening down here and we are getting really close to where we need to be for the temple to come down here.
